Top 5 Military Games on iOS in Latin America: Q1 2025
Explore the performance trends of the top military games on iOS in Latin America for Q1 2025, with insights from Sensor Tower.
In the first quarter of 2025, the iOS platform in Latin America saw notable trends among the top military games. Here's a closer look at the performance of these popular apps, based on data from Sensor Tower.
Call of Duty®: Mobile from Activision Publishing, Inc. experienced fluctuating weekly revenue, peaking at approximately $644K in mid-January. Downloads remained relatively stable, starting at around 111K and ending at 79K by the end of March. The game maintained a strong user base with weekly active users hovering around 1.9M at the beginning of the quarter, slightly decreasing to 1.6M by the end.
Blood Strike - FPS for all by NetEase Games showed a rising trend in weekly revenue, reaching around $61K in mid-March. Downloads varied, starting at 57K and dropping to 32K towards the quarter's end. Active users peaked at over 335K initially, with a slight decline to 298K by the close of Q1.
Arena Breakout: Realistic FPS from Level Infinite had modest revenue figures, peaking at around $20K in mid-March. Downloads decreased from 10K to 8K over the quarter. Active users started at 68K, seeing a slight increase to 75K by February before stabilizing.
Top War: Battle Game by River Game HK Limited experienced varied revenue, with a notable increase to $12K in March. Downloads started at 6K but reduced significantly to under 1K by the end of the period. Active users began at 10K, showing a gradual decline to 6K.
Standoff 2 by AXLEBOLT LTD saw weekly revenue peaking at around $15K in late December. Downloads ranged from 12K to 10K throughout the quarter. Active users started at 76K, decreasing to 56K by the end.
